什么是消毒?
Disinfection is the process of cleaning something with a chemical in order to destroy bacteria. The specific chemical that we are using for disinfection is named the disinfectant. Disinfectants are chemicals that are used to remove or inactivate microorganisms in inert surfaces. However, they do not necessarily kill all microorganisms. 什么是熏蒸?
Fumigation is a technique of pest control or removal of harmful microorganisms in an area using a gaseous pesticide. This gaseous pesticide is known as a fumigant. A fumigant can suffocate or poison the pests within that area. The process of fumigation can control pests in buildings, soil, grain, and produce. Moreover, the fumigation process is useful during the processing of goods that are ready to be imported or exported in order to prevent the transfer of exotic organisms.

什么是消毒?
Sanitization is the technique of cleaning and making a hygienic environment. This process is useful in making the area bacteria-free and cleaning all types of microbes and viruses that are able to infect the human body and can cause different diseases.

Surface sanitization is an important process of cleaning surfaces where we can remove or destroy microorganisms from places such as clothing, vegetables, water, and other hard surfaces. Sanitization is done using chemicals that do not harm the human body.
